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e

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e

Raw materials: PE100, PE4710, PE100RC

Standard: ISO 4427/EN 12201/S/NZS 4130

Diameter range: DN50mm-630mm

Pressure levels: SDR17, SDR13.6, SDR11, SDR9

PN10PN12.5PN16PN20

Certification: UL, WRAS, NSF, ISO, CE

Length: 5.8 meters (20 feet), 11.8-12 meters//L40 feet

Color: Black background with blue stripes (customizable color)

1. What is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e and what is its function in fire protection systems?

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e is a high-density polyethylene pressure pipe designed for reliable water transportation in fire protection networks. The blue stripe identification helps distinguish the pipeline from other utility systems, while the HDPE material provides excellent pressure performance, corrosion resistance, and long-term durability for underground fire water supply applications.


2. Why is HDPE material suitable for fire water pipeline systems compared with traditional metal pipes?

HDPE provides superior corrosion resistance compared with traditional steel or ductile iron fire pipes. It does not rust, corrode, or require protective coatings, even in aggressive soil conditions. Its flexibility also allows the pipe to absorb ground movement, vibration, and settlement, making it highly suitable for underground fire protection infrastructure.


3. What are the main applications of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e in industrial and municipal projects?

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e is commonly used in underground fire hydrant systems, fire pump water supply pipelines, sprinkler networks, industrial fire protection systems, commercial buildings, airports, ports, energy facilities, and municipal emergency water supply projects. It is designed for applications requiring reliable and continuous fire water delivery.


4. How does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e maintain hydraulic efficiency during fire emergency operations?

The smooth internal surface of HDPE reduces friction losses and improves water flow efficiency compared with rougher pipe materials. This helps maintain stable pressure and higher flow capacity during firefighting operations. The low hydraulic resistance also reduces pumping energy requirements in large fire protection networks.


5. What pressure ratings are available for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e systems?

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e can be manufactured in different pressure classes, including PN6, PN10, PN12.5, and PN16, depending on project requirements. The appropriate pressure rating is selected according to fire system design pressure, required flow rate, pump capacity, installation depth, and local fire protection standards.


6. How is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e installed and connected for underground fire protection systems?

Installation methods typically include butt fusion, electrofusion, or approved mechanical connections depending on pipe diameter and project specifications. Fusion welding creates strong, leak-resistant joints that maintain the pressure capability of the pipeline. Proper trench preparation, bedding support, pressure testing, and flushing are essential for reliable fire system performance.


7. Can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e be used in high-risk environments such as industrial plants and coastal areas?

Yes,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e is suitable for demanding environments including industrial zones, chemical facilities, coastal areas, and regions with high groundwater levels. Its resistance to saltwater, chemicals, and corrosion ensures long-term reliability where conventional metal fire pipelines may experience premature deterioration.


8. How does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e compare with steel fire pipes in terms of lifecycle performance?

Compared with steel fire pipes,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e offers longer service life, lower maintenance requirements, and improved resistance to corrosion. Its lightweight structure reduces transportation and installation costs, while its flexible characteristics minimize the risk of cracking caused by ground movement or external stress.


9. What is the expected service life of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e in underground fire protection applications?

Under proper engineering design and installation conditions, Blue Stripe HDPE Fire Pipe can provide a service life of more than 50 years. Its resistance to corrosion, chemical degradation, and environmental stress cracking allows it to maintain structural and hydraulic performance throughout long-term underground operation.
